My ram: Corsair CMX 512 - 3200C2

mobo: MSI K8N Neo2

This is the chart that the MSI board shows as far as configuration is concerned:

S:Single Sided D: Double Sided B: Blank

Ram Speed - Slot 1 - Slot 2 - Slot 3 - Slot 4

DDR400 - S - B - B - B
DDR400 - B - B - S - B
DDR400 - D - B - B - B
DDR400 - B - B - D - B
DDR400 - S - B - S - B
DDR333 - D - B - D - B
DDR400 - S - S - B - B
DDR400 - B - B - S - S
DDR400 - D - D - B - B
DDR400 - B - B - D - D
DDR400 - D - D - D - D
DDR333 - S - S - S - S

So, am I placing them in either 1+2 or 3+4? And, does that mean I am not using this in dual channel?
